carload
/ˈkɑːləʊd/
Dictionary
noun
- The contents of an automobile (passengers, supplies, etc.) for one trip.
"I brought a carload of flowers to her."
- The quantity of goods that can be carried in a freight car.
"less-than-carload freight"
